How does Macbeth come to be Thane of Cawdor? Cite lines from Act I of The Tragedy of Macbeth
Otrada [13]

Answer:

After the previous Thane of Cawdor is found guilty of treason, Duncan bequeaths his title on Macbeth in gratitude for Macbeth's courage in battle.
